What You'll Do
- Oversees deposits of cash on time while keeping accurate accounting records
- Keeps the manager up to date on all relevant and appropriate matters as it pertains to his/her position
- Prepares monthly journal entries and maintains complete records of these transactions
- Reconciles bank statements and keeps an accurate running total of cash on hand
- Ensures monthly balance sheet account reconciliations are prepared timely and accurately
- Compile and analyze financial information to prepare financial statements including monthly and quarterly management reports in accordance to U.S. GAAP
- Oversees accurate and appropriate recording and analysis of revenues and expenses and ensure financial records are maintained in compliance with accepted policies and procedures
- Ensures accurate and timely monthly, quarterly and year-end close processes making certain all financial reporting deadlines are met
- Assists in preparation and submission of quarterly and annual reports as required by Department of Managed Health Care’s agreement
- Submits quarterly and annual financial reports to the health plans
- Supports the budget and forecast activities; including fluxes preparation against actual results
- Prepares for financial audit and coordinate the audit process including working with external auditors and health plans
- Ensures compliance with relevant laws and regulations and integrity of financial data
- Assists with ad-hoc procedures and tasks as requested from management

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ene
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.
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
-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
-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
